SUMMARY: 

The Lead Category Manager is accountable for developing and executing strategic category plans that maximize value, optimize total cost of ownership (TCO), and mitigate risk across assigned spend categories. This role leverages data-driven insights, market intelligence, and cross-functional collaboration to deliver sustainable business results and strengthen supplier performance.

RESPONSIBILITIES:
• Manages assigned categories to optimize the supply base and deliver maximum value to the Business.
• Identifies and executes value delivery (cost savings, cost avoidance, revenue enhancement) and risk reduction opportunities within assigned categories.
• Analyzes and interprets data for use in decision-making and actions in support of category strategy, including TCO and should cost modeling.
• Develops, implements, and manages category strategies with focus on the value proposition, commercial agreement execution and administration.
• Develops and manages strategic partnerships with internal and external Stakeholders; to include collaboration with Stakeholders to align on category strategies, understand the demand/spend profile of risks and Business requirements.
• Develops and manages KPIs for measuring performance for key Suppliers. Facilitate issue resolution related to Supplier performance.
• Leads utilization and performance assessments to confirm strategies are effective and strategic Suppliers are meeting and exceeding expectations.
• Identifies and leads strategic sourcing projects within assigned categories, analyze business objectives, develop project plan and charter, lead and/or facilitate cross functional teams to ensure milestones are met, track project progress and monitor performance against plan, facilitate meetings, prepare reports and presentations to communicate status.
• Collaborates with stakeholders to understand the demand/spend profile of assigned category and sub- categories. Responsible for the strategy development to mitigate risks and to ensure best in class support for our ongoing business requirements.
• Mentors Category Analyst to ensure all aspects of the category strategy are being executed.

Marathon Petroleum Corporation (MPC) is a leading, integrated, downstream energy company headquartered in Findlay, Ohio. The company operates the nation's largest refining system. MPC's marketing system includes branded locations across the United States, including Marathon brand retail outlets. MPC also owns the general partner and majority limited partner interest in MPLX LP, a midstream company that owns and operates gathering, processing, and fractionation assets, as well as crude oil and light product transportation and logistics infrastructure.
